What is Iranian Singing?

Iranian singing, also known as Persian classical singing, is a form of vocal expression closely associated with Persian classical music. Known for its intricate melodies and expressive qualities, Persian singing often draws on themes of nature, love, and spirituality. Singers learn specific ornamentations, microtones, and vocal techniques that make this genre unique. This style demands a blend of technical skill, emotional sensitivity, and an understanding of the poetic traditions of Persian music.

Why Learn Persian Singing?

Connect with Persian Culture

Learning Iranian singing allows students to immerse themselves in Persian culture. Many Persian songs are based on poetry from celebrated Persian poets like Hafez, Rumi, and Saadi. Understanding and singing these works brings a profound connection to the cultural heritage of Iran.

Unique Vocal Techniques

Iranian singing incorporates unique techniques, such as melismatic phrases and ornamentation, which make it a distinctive style. Mastering these techniques enhances a singer’s overall vocal ability and range.

Music in Calgary

It is true that there are not many music tours in this city, but it is expected that in the coming decades, Calgary will become a very special place for Canadian music. Although Calgary is underdeveloped, the city will have a bright future in the music industry due to its focus on creating a thriving scene in which local artists can start and maintain successful careers. The Palace Theater, Plaza Theater, Bella Hall, Jack Singer Concert Hall, McEwan Hall, and Jubilee Hall are just some of the most important music venues in the city. Jane Arden, Chad van Galen, Fist, New Agre, John Wanat, Lisa Lobsinger, Lindsay Ell, and Kisa are some of the city's most famous singers and musicians. There are also many music festivals in the city, including Calgary Folk Music.
